#0bc910 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0bc910 is composed of 4.3% red, 78.8%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 92%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 121.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 41.6%. #0bc910 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ff20 with #009300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#0bc910
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f01 is the darkest color, while #fbf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#0bc910
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656f65 is the less saturated color, while #03d108 is the most saturated one.
